sound Issues...sounds don't stop

Recommended Posts

I've always sort of had this issue but it's driving me nuts tonight as I try to fix the annunciator issue by loading and saving panel states.

 

Whenever I shut things down in the NGX to cold and dark and everything goes silent except it still sounds like something is humming so I switch views. When it gets outside it is silent, then when I get back to the cockpit there's all kinds of sounds that don't stop even though EVERYTHING is off. It's driving me insane I can't get sounds to stop and when I load my saved cold and dark panel state I'm still getting them. Why are sounds stopping, and then just starting randomly when I change views?

Hey there,

 

got the  same sound issues. For me it works, just to hit the pause button (P) right after I've returned from outside camera  to the "cold and dark" cockpit. Then, I simply  quit the pause- mode by pressing "P" again and all false sounds go silent.  Give it a try!
